Experience a 5k trail race through the Chapman Mountain Nature Preserve on a course featuring grass gravel and dirt paths. This Huntsville event is a featured part of the Huntsville Track Club Grand Prix series.
This event at Gadsden Battlefield on June 19 and 20, 2026 features a 10K obstacle race with competitive and noncompetitive divisions, an 80 foot rope climb, a kids challenge, and volunteer roles.
A four race trail series in Huntsville with multiple distances, aid stations, a series t shirt and finisher awards. Each race features varied trail terrain including bluffs, creek crossings, and waterfalls.
Timed night and day trail races on a 3-mile loop at Henry Horton State Park, offering 3, 6, 12 and 24 hour formats, on-course aid, finisher medals, event prizes, and nonprofit proceeds for local school children.
A trail race at Monte Sano State Park offering 10K and half marathon options as Race 4 of the Wild Thangs Trail Series, featuring bluff views, creek crossings and multiple aid stations.
Experience a unique multi day ultramarathon where your age determines your clock. Run as many miles as possible on a one mile loop in a community focused event that celebrates veteran athletes and long distance legends.
A looped endurance event in Birmingham's Railroad Park where runners repeat an approximately 0.78 mile circuit with progressively shorter cutoffs until they stop or miss a cutoff. Awards go to the last three men and women and a portion of f..
Experience a unique 5K run through a scenic valley and a lit cavern in Alabama. Enjoy mountain views and a subterranean turn around point with constant cool temperatures.
A Last Runner Standing Backyard Ultra in Bell Buckle, TN, run on a repeat loop of 4.1666667 miles. Entry is limited to the first 75 registrants and a wait list opens when the field fills.
A backyard ultra at Wade Mountain Preserve near Huntsville where runners complete repeated 4.167 mile loops, move to road during darkness, and keep running until one person completes more laps than anyone else.
A Last Man Standing backyard ultra in Bell Buckle TN on October 17 2026, part of the World Backyard Ultra Team Championships; field is limited to athletes who qualified via silver tickets or at large selection.
